What is Troop Financial Report

The 301-FM Troop Financial Report is a cash flow statement used by troop leaders and treasurers to document all financial transactions for a troop.

Comprehensive Guide to Troop Financial Report

What is the 301-FM Troop Financial Report?

The 301-FM Troop Financial Report serves as a comprehensive record for troop financial tracking, capturing essential financial transactions. Key elements of this document include payments, receipts, and detailed transaction records, which are crucial for maintaining accurate accounts within the troop. The Troop Treasurer and Service Unit Auditor play significant roles in preparing and reviewing this report, ensuring that all financial activities are documented and properly managed.

Purpose and Benefits of Completing a Troop Financial Report

Accurate tracking of troop finances is vital for effective management and transparency. A well-maintained troop financial report fosters trust among members and supports sound financial planning. Additionally, proper documentation simplifies the audit process, allowing for easier verification of the troop’s financial standing and activities.

Key Features of the 301-FM Troop Financial Report

The 301-FM Troop Financial Report contains various blank fields intended for troop information, transaction records, and bank details. Critical signature requirements ensure the document's validity as the Troop Treasurer and Service Unit Auditor must both sign. Enhanced usability features, such as capabilities for tracking weekly dues and payments, further support effective management of troop finances.

Who Needs to Complete the 301-FM Troop Financial Report?

The primary users of the 301-FM Troop Financial Report are the Troop Treasurer and Service Unit Auditor. These roles carry specific responsibilities that are essential for compliance with internal standards within the scouting organization. Accurate submission from these designated positions is crucial for fulfilling reporting requirements and maintaining financial integrity.
